The 2003 film is a romantic drama starring Shah Rukh Khan and Rani Mukerji . Directed by Aziz Mirza , it is recognized for its mature exploration of how "happily ever after" works in the face of real-world marital friction. Film Overview Release Date: June 13, 2003.
